In this episode of The Directed Life, Kap Chatfield and Luke Reelfs explore how God uses dreams and visions to speak, guide, and prepare His people. Drawing from Scripture and the life of Daniel, they reveal why dreams are not random, why interpretation matters, and how God often speaks when distractions are quiet.
This conversation unpacks how biblical leaders were guided through dreams before major shifts, and how believers today can steward dreams with wisdom, discernment, and biblical alignment. You’ll learn how to recognize God’s voice, honor what He reveals, and walk in clarity as God continues to speak in this season.
